Faith without actions, worship without obedience, and sympathy without solutions are hollow, phony expressions. It’s time to take up the challenge of the Epistle of James and get busy making a difference in the real world. No more sterile, antiseptic Christianity allowed. It’s time to get your hands dirty and follow Jesus with an authentic faith. It’s time to get real in your relationship with God and saturate the world with His real solutions.

This book, specifically designed for teens and young adults, Includes questions and activities for application and discussion, plus special sections with advice for the teacher.

About the Author

Andrew Phillips, a native of Memphis, TN, graduated from Freed-Hardeman University with bachelor’s degrees in Bible and Communication, as well as Harding Graduate School of Religion with an M.A. in Christian Doctrine. He has previously served in education ministry, and he has a passion for teaching Scripture. Andrew and his wife Kathryn have two sons, Luke and Micah.
